windowslinux文件夹传输命令

不及物动词 其他 170

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Windows和Linux是两种常用的操作系统,它们之间的文件夹传输命令可以帮助我们在两个系统之间快速、安全地传输文件夹。

    在Windows系统中,使用命令行工具(Command Prompt)可以使用以下命令进行文件夹传输:

    1. 使用xcopy命令:
    “`shell
    xcopy <源文件夹路径> <目标文件夹路径> /E /I /H /Y
    “`
    其中,`<源文件夹路径>`是要传输的文件夹的路径,`<目标文件夹路径>`是传输后文件夹的目标路径。选项`/E`表示复制所有子文件夹和文件,`/I`表示如果目标文件夹不存在则创建,`/H`表示复制系统和隐藏文件,`/Y`表示覆盖现有文件而不提示。

    2. 使用robocopy命令:
    “`shell
    robocopy <源文件夹路径> <目标文件夹路径> /E /MIR /ZB
    “`
    同样,`<源文件夹路径>`是要传输的文件夹的路径,`<目标文件夹路径>`是传输后文件夹的目标路径。选项`/E`表示复制所有子文件夹和文件,`/MIR`表示镜像复制,即源文件夹和目标文件夹保持一致,`/ZB`表示以备份模式进行复制,以保证文件的完整性。

    在Linux系统中,使用命令行工具(Terminal)可以使用以下命令进行文件夹传输:

    1. 使用cp命令:
    “`shell
    cp -r <源文件夹路径> <目标文件夹路径>
    “`
    同样,`<源文件夹路径>`是要传输的文件夹的路径,`<目标文件夹路径>`是传输后文件夹的目标路径。选项`-r`表示递归复制,即复制所有子文件夹和文件。

    2. 使用rsync命令:
    “`shell
    rsync -avz <源文件夹路径> <目标文件夹路径>
    “`
    同样,`<源文件夹路径>`是要传输的文件夹的路径,`<目标文件夹路径>`是传输后文件夹的目标路径。选项`-a`表示以归档模式进行复制,保留文件的所有属性,`-v`表示输出详细信息,`-z`表示压缩传输,以加快传输速度。

    以上是在Windows和Linux系统中进行文件夹传输的常用命令,可以根据具体需求选择合适的命令进行操作。希望对你有所帮助!

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Windows和Linux操作系统中,有几个可以用于传输文件夹的常用命令。以下是这些命令及其用法的简要介绍:

    1. Windows命令:ROBOCOPY
    ROBOCOPY命令是一个功能强大的Windows命令行工具,用于复制文件夹和文件。它支持复制文件夹及其所有子文件夹和文件,以及保留原有的文件属性、时间戳等。以下是ROBOCOPY命令的基本用法示例:
    “`bash
    ROBOCOPY /S <源文件夹路径> <目标文件夹路径>
    “`

    2. Linux命令:rsync
    rsync命令是一个用于在Linux系统之间进行文件和文件夹同步的工具。它可以通过ssh协议进行加密传输,并且可以仅传输更改的部分。以下是rsync命令的基本用法示例:
    “`bash
    rsync -avz <源文件夹路径> <目标文件夹路径>
    “`

    3. Windows命令:XCOPY
    XCOPY命令是Windows系统中的另一个用于复制文件夹和文件的命令。与ROBOCOPY相比,它的功能较简单,可以复制文件夹及其子文件夹和文件,但不能保留所有文件属性。以下是XCOPY命令的基本用法示例:
    “`bash
    XCOPY /S <源文件夹路径> <目标文件夹路径>
    “`

    4. Linux命令:scp
    scp命令是用于在Linux系统之间进行安全文件传输的工具,它使用ssh协议进行加密传输。以下是scp命令的基本用法示例:
    “`bash
    scp -r <源文件夹路径> <目标主机>:<目标文件夹路径>
    “`
    注意:在这个命令中,<目标主机>是目标计算机的IP地址或主机名。

    5. Windows命令:FTP
    FTP(文件传输协议)是一种用于在计算机之间进行文件传输的标准协议。在Windows系统中,可以使用ftp命令来进行文件夹传输。首先需要在目标计算机上启动FTP服务器,然后使用以下命令连接到目标计算机并进行文件传输:
    “`bash
    ftp <目标计算机IP>
    “`
    然后输入用户名和密码来登录FTP服务器,之后可以使用put命令将文件夹上传到服务器,使用get命令从服务器下载文件夹。

    以上是在Windows和Linux操作系统中用于文件夹传输的常用命令。根据自己的需求和操作习惯,可以选择适合的命令来进行文件夹传输。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Windows和Linux系统中,可以使用不同的命令来进行文件夹的传输。下面将介绍几种常用的方法。

    一、使用FTP命令传输文件夹
    FTP(File Transfer Protocol)是一种用于在网络上进行文件传输的协议。通过使用FTP命令,可以在Windows和Linux系统之间传输文件夹。以下是在Windows或Linux系统上使用FTP命令进行文件夹传输的步骤:

    1. 在源系统上启动FTP客户端。在Windows系统中,可以使用命令行或者使用FTP软件(如FileZilla)来启动FTP客户端。在Linux系统中,可以使用命令行中的ftp命令来启动FTP客户端。

    2. 连接到目标系统。在FTP客户端的命令行中,输入以下命令来连接到目标系统:
    “`
    ftp 目标系统IP地址
    “`

    3. 使用用户名和密码登录目标系统。在连接成功后,输入用户名和密码来登录目标系统。

    4. 进入文件夹。使用cd命令进入要传输的文件夹。

    5. 开始传输文件夹。使用mput命令(在Windows系统中)或put命令(在Linux系统中)来上传文件夹到目标系统。

    二、使用SCP命令传输文件夹
    SCP(Secure Copy)是一种在网络上安全地进行文件传输的协议。以下是在Windows或Linux系统上使用SCP命令进行文件夹传输的步骤:

    1. 在源系统上打开命令行。在Windows系统中,可以使用命令行或者使用SSH客户端(如PuTTY)来打开命令行。在Linux系统中,可以直接在终端中打开命令行。

    2. 连接到目标系统。在命令行中,输入以下命令来连接到目标系统:
    “`
    scp -r 源文件夹 目标系统用户名@目标系统IP地址:目标文件夹路径
    “`

    3. 输入密码并确认传输。连接成功后,输入目标系统的密码,并确认传输。

    三、使用Samba命令传输文件夹
    Samba是一种在Windows和Linux系统之间进行文件共享的软件。通过使用Samba命令,可以在Windows和Linux系统之间传输文件夹。以下是在Windows或Linux系统上使用Samba命令进行文件夹传输的步骤:

    1. 在源系统上打开命令行。在Windows系统中,可以使用命令行或者在资源管理器中输入地址栏中输入“\\目标系统IP地址”来打开命令行。在Linux系统中,可以直接在终端中打开命令行。

    2. 使用用户名和密码连接到目标系统。在命令行中,输入以下命令来连接到目标系统:
    “`
    net use 目标系统IP地址 目标系统用户名 /user:目标系统用户名
    “`

    3. 进入文件夹。使用cd命令进入要传输的文件夹。

    4. 拷贝文件夹到目标系统。使用copy命令将文件夹拷贝到目标系统:
    “`
    copy 源文件夹 目标文件夹路径
    “`

    以上是在Windows和Linux系统之间进行文件夹传输的几种常用方法。根据实际情况选择适合自己的方法进行操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部